Senior Vice President, CommercialDanone North AmericaAriel Dalton is a seasoned, high-impact executive with over 17 years of experience leading transformational commercial strategy, sales, and go-to-market operations in the fast-moving consumer goods (FMCG) industry.
Currently serving as Senior Vice President of Commercial at Danone North America, Ariel is recognized for her dynamic leadership, ability to drive top- and bottom-line growth, and unmatched talent for building engaged, high-performing teams. Before joining the manufacturing side of CPG, Ariel began her career at a top-tier direct marketing agency, where she ignited her passion for consumer goods. Since then, she has built her career at Danone across both U.S. headquarters, leading growth across traditional channels like Grocery and Mass as well as emerging, strategic channels including eCommerce, Foodservice, and Military—some of the fastest-growing verticals in the industry. Ariel is equally passionate about people and culture, managing a highly engaged team of 145 Danoners with a broker network of over 4,500. She served as a leader of Danone’s LIFT Women’s Leadership ERG, was an active member of the Network of Executive Women (now NextUp) and was recognized at the Makers Conference as one of Danone’s most influential female leaders. Beyond her corporate achievements, Ariel is committed to authentic leadership and mentorship. She’s a graduate of the IMD High Performance Leadership Program and USC’s Food Industry Executive Program and has been trained in advanced negotiation through The Gap Partnership. She also brings a global perspective, having studied international marketing and communication theory at the University of Oxford and led several global initiatives and projects for Danone, including serving most recently as the North America Sales AI lead for Customer Value Creation.
